Categoría – IT

Posibles aplicaciones de Deep Learning

  • por javier
  • 22 de Marzo de 2023

Machine Learning y Deep Learning comenzaron su andadura en el siglo pasado y están de moda últimamente gracias a una mayor capacidad de cómputo en nuestras máquinas. En un futuro cercano, las aplicaciones de dicha tecnología aumentarán exponencialmente y acabarán siendo de uso cotidiano para cualquier programador. Podemos darle muchos usos al Machine Learning y a Deep Learning. En éste artículo me centraré en Deep Learning. En Deep Learning se utilizan Redes Neuronales ya sean Convolutional Neural Networks, Recurrent Neural Networks, Sequence Models… cada una de ellas tiene un uso específico pero nos centraremos más en los usos que se …

Programacion Multihilo en Python mediante Ejemplos

  • por javier
  • 22 de Marzo de 2023
None
Mini - Ladrillo
 
En determinadas ocasiones, resulta necesario ejecutar varias tareas al mismo tiempo para ganar en velocidad de proceso. 
Estas tareas pueden ser similares o bien diferentes y a veces utilizan el mismo recurso simultaneamente o bien necesitan comunicarse entre ellos para coordinarse; esto puede dar problemas, pero la programación multihilo nos permite solucionar estas situaciones mediante varios recursos, cada uno adecuado o necesario en un caso u otro. 

ALGORITMOS GENETICOS. PROBLEMA DE LAS 8 REINAS EN PYTHON

  • por javier
  • 22 de Marzo de 2023
None

La idea de Algoritmos Genéticos, se basa en la teoría de la evolución de las especies, de Charles Darwin (1859). La idea principal es que las variaciones o mutaciones, ocurren en la reproducción y serán conservadas en base a la idoneidad reproductiva.

Los Algoritmos Genéticos se basan en la búsqueda paralela de soluciones, hasta dar con una suficientemente válida o se aborta el programa si no se encuentra dicha solución y el tiempo transcurrido de cómputo no es aceptable.

Inicialmente se genera una población (soluciones posibles en un array), que van regenerándose en base a un cruce de 2 individuos …

Data Entry System. Un Framework Completo para DATA ENTRY

  • por javier
  • 22 de Marzo de 2023

Hace tiempo publiqué un framework. Me llevó varios años de trabajo y quedé más o menos satisfecho con el producto final.

Se trata de un Framework de Data Entry (Data Entry System). Este framework permite hacer cosas como, a partir de imágenes, procesar con OCR , grabación de datos, verificación de datos , estadísticas y exportación de datos en formato csv.

El framework está diseñado para la actuación de 3 roles diferentes dentro de la aplicación:

Update cookies preferences